10. Philadelphia Eagles: Jeffrey Okudah, CB, Ohio State

The Philadelphia Eagles cornerback depth chart isn’t ideal, but starters Ronald Darby and Sidney Jones are more than solid, if health wasn’t a factor. Insert the next great corner from DBU Ohio State in Jeffrey Okudah, who would be Philly’s top guy from day one.

11. Los Angeles Chargers: Trey Adams, OT, Washington

The Los Angeles Chargers have long needed a left tackle for Philip Rivers and they land theirs in Trey Adams. Adams has dealt with a plethora of injuries throughout his career, but he looks fantastic in 2019 with a clean bill of health.

12. Indianapolis Colts: Derrick Brown, DL, Auburn

Yes, I have the Indianapolis Colts passing on a quarterback in round one of the 2020 NFL Draft. Instead, the Colts make their defensive line even stronger with Auburn’s Derrick Brown. Brown is a bad man who could’ve been a day one selection in 2019 if he wanted… he’s a lock for round one status for 2020.
